[QUOTE="Entrenched, post: 10699479, member: 105684"] So I posted before that I trashed the clutch on my last trip to the track. I decided to do some major upgrades while I had the clutch out. Added a Saleen grill and C/S valance [ATTACH=full]187850[/ATTACH] Roush side splitters [ATTACH=full]187851[/ATTACH] GT500 Brembos, Goodridge stainless brake lines, Super Blue Fluid, painted rear calipers, Koni SRT struts and shocks, MM front endlinks, FRPP sway bar bushings front and rear, FRPP rear endlinks [ATTACH=full]187852[/ATTACH] [ATTACH=full]187853[/ATTACH] [ATTACH=full]187854[/ATTACH] Welded axle tubes, Detroit True Trac, LPW cover, CHE axle brace, Painted rear housing [ATTACH=full]187855[/ATTACH] [ATTACH=full]187856[/ATTACH] [ATTACH=full]187857[/ATTACH] [ATTACH=full]187858[/ATTACH] Mcleod RXT, JPC stainless clutch line, GT500 pedal assy, CHE DS safety loop, Boss LS Trans cooler. Stock clutch had a very loose spring, PP had two bolts backed out, and a few bent fingers. New clutch feels great and the transmission no longer balks at going into reverse and first gear. The clutch does release very high but I have the Ram pedal adjuster coming to fix the issue (at the suggestion of Mcleod).
